Output 0d7387f830404b5d594fee25f6061a4b6c20b19b1be51db95ddbfc08b1d42ece:22

value
2166964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2f2628edfeffc81f6d6a89adccd677b48e0404d OP_EQUAL
address
3KToNxq61Kk3A8VueGueP4d5WvSibZSwjX
transaction
0d7387f830404b5d594fee25f6061a4b6c20b19b1be51db95ddbfc08b1d42ece
spent
true